Example #1
0
        private void buttonModificar_Click(object sender, EventArgs e)
        {
            ClaseMascotas mascotas = new ClaseMascotas();

            mascotas.setID(int.Parse(textBoxID.Text.Trim()));
            mascotas.setNombre(textBoxNombre.Text.Trim());
            mascotas.setEspecie(comboBoxEspecie.Text.Trim());
            mascotas.setRaza(textBoxRaza.Text.Trim());
            mascotas.setEdad(int.Parse(textBoxEdad.Text.Trim()));
            if (radioButtonF.Checked)
            {
                mascotas.setSexo('F');
            }
            else
            {
                mascotas.setSexo('M');
            }
            mascotas.setPropietario(int.Parse(textBoxPropietario.Text.Trim()));
            mascotas.setActivo(true);
            if (ClaseMascotas.ActualizarMascotas(mascotas) > 0)
            {
                MessageBox.Show("Los datos de la Mascota se actualizaron", "Datos Actualizados", MessageBoxButtons.OK, MessageBoxIcon.Information);
            }
            else
            {
                MessageBox.Show("No se pudo actualizar", "Error al Actualizar",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
        }
Example #2
0
        private void buttonAgregar_Click(object sender, EventArgs e)
        {
            ClaseMascotas mascotas = new ClaseMascotas();

            mascotas.setNombre(textBoxNombre.Text.Trim());
            mascotas.setEspecie(comboBoxEspecie.Text.Trim());
            mascotas.setRaza(textBoxRaza.Text.Trim());
            mascotas.setEdad(int.Parse(textBoxEdad.Text.Trim()));
            if (radioButtonF.Checked)
            {
                mascotas.setSexo('F');
            }
            else
            {
                mascotas.setSexo('M');
            }
            mascotas.setPropietario(int.Parse(textBoxPropietario.Text.Trim()));
            mascotas.setActivo(true);
            int resultado = ClaseMascotas.AgregarMascotas(mascotas);

            if (resultado > 0)
            {
                MessageBox.Show("Mascota guardada correctamente", "Guardado!!", MessageBoxButtons.OK, MessageBoxIcon.Information);
            }
            else
            {
                MessageBox.Show("No se pudo guardar la Mascota", "Fallo!!",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
            }
        }
Example #3
0
        public static int AgregarMascotas(ClaseMascotas mascotas)
        {
            int             retorno  = 0;
            MySqlConnection conexion = Conexion.ObtenerConexion();
            MySqlCommand    comando  = new MySqlCommand(string.Format("Insert into mascotas (id, nombre, especie, raza, edad, sexo, " +
                                                                      "propietario, activo) values('{0}','{1}','{2}','{3}','{4}','{5}','{6}','{7}')",
                                                                      mascotas.ID, mascotas.Nombre, mascotas.Especie, mascotas.Raza, mascotas.Edad, mascotas.Sexo, mascotas.Propietario, mascotas.Activo), conexion);

            retorno = comando.ExecuteNonQuery();
            conexion.Close();
            return(retorno);
        }
Example #4
0
        public static int ActualizarMascotas(ClaseMascotas mascotas)
        {
            int             retorno  = 0;
            MySqlConnection conexion = Conexion.ObtenerConexion();

            MySqlCommand comando = new MySqlCommand(string.Format("Update mascotas set nombre='{0}', especie='{1}', raza='{2}', edad='{3}', sexo='{4}', propietario='{5}', activo='{6}' where ID='{7}'",
                                                                  mascotas.Nombre, mascotas.Especie, mascotas.Raza, mascotas.Edad, mascotas.Sexo, mascotas.Propietario, mascotas.Activo, mascotas.ID), conexion);

            retorno = comando.ExecuteNonQuery();
            conexion.Close();

            return(retorno);
        }
Example #5
0
 private void buttonEliminar_Click(object sender, EventArgs e)
 {
     if (MessageBox.Show("Esta Seguro que desea eliminar la Mascota actual", "Estas Seguro??",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
     {
         if (ClaseMascotas.EliminarMascotas(int.Parse(textBoxID.Text.Trim())) > 0)
         {
             MessageBox.Show("Mascota Eliminada Correctamente!", "Mascota Eliminada", MessageBoxButtons.OK, MessageBoxIcon.Information);
         }
         else
         {
             MessageBox.Show("No se pudo eliminar la Mascota", "Mascota No Eliminada",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
         }
     }
     else
     {
         MessageBox.Show("Se cancelo la eliminacion", "Eliminacion Cancelada", MessageBoxButtons.OK, MessageBoxIcon.Exclamation);
     }
 }